Abstract
Purpose
The academic experience of top management team (TMT) has a positive impact on firms' innovation performance. However, existing studies predominantly focus on the educational qualifications and institutional prestige of TMT, failing to comprehensively evaluate whether TMT possess genuine academic experience and the role of academic competence. This article aims to examine whether TMT academic competence has a potential influence on firm innovation performance and to understand the mechanisms behind this relationship.
Design/methodology/approach
Using firm-level metrics of Chinese listed firms and TMT scholarly publication data spanning 2000–2021, this paper investigates whether TMT academic competence can promote firms' innovation performance and conducts a moderated mediating effect analysis.
Findings
(1) Academic competence of TMT can contribute positively to firms’ innovation performance; (2) university–industry collaboration partially mediates this relationship; (3) the mediating effect is enhanced by cognitive proximity and (4) distance proximity does not diminish the mediating effect.
Research limitations/implications
Outcome of this study can assist academia in further understanding the impacts of TMT on firm innovation and aid government in promoting university–industry collaboration. Simultaneously, it can help firms adjust their TMT selection and training strategies to enhance innovation performance.
Originality/value
This article, as the first to construct an index of academic competence and to explore whether it has an impact on firms' innovation performance and its inherent mechanism, can provide a new research perspective for the study of the impact of TMT's characteristics on firms' innovation.

Abstract
Purpose
The purpose of this study is to investigate university–industry partnerships in Armenia from the viewpoint of universities. By doing so, it contributes to the existing literature on university–industry collaboration by identifying and addressing the specific challenges that impede the establishment of successful university–industry partnerships in Armenia and other post-Soviet countries.
Design/methodology/approach
A comprehensive literature review was conducted to examine the barriers, benefits and institutional, functional framework of collaboration. Additionally, this study used a survey methodology to gather data from faculty managing staff members at six Armenian higher educational institutions on various aspects of university–industry collaboration as well as the perceptions and experiences of the participants.
Findings
The results show that the effectiveness and applicability of the university–industry collaboration channels and institutional structures in six higher educational institutions are limited. Specifically, the channels that rely on academic entrepreneurship and innovation were found to be currently unviable. Moreover, the existence of spin-offs and start-ups is notably absent. Furthermore, limited access to funding and inadequate entrepreneurial support systems pose significant barriers to developing university–industry partnerships in Armenian reality.
Originality/value
This study represents a pioneering effort within the context of Armenian higher educational institutions, as it is the first time a survey has been organized to specifically investigate the topic of university–industry partnerships. Before this study, there was a lack of empirical research and data collection on this topic in Armenian higher education settings. Therefore, this research holds significant originality and contributes to filling the existing gap in knowledge regarding university–industry partnerships in Armenia. The research is shedding light on a previously unexplored area and providing a valuable contribution to the field of university–industry collaboration research in Armenia and other post-Soviet countries.

Abstract
Purpose
University–industry projects provide special challenges in understanding and expressing the values required of project management (PM) in delivering stakeholder benefits. This paper presents a framework for understanding, identifying and managing the values of PM in major university–industry R&D projects.
Design/methodology/approach
The value framework identifies for each of the key stakeholders, the key PM values that may require to be managed and are largely derived from research literature. Empirical research then explores, prioritises and selects key PM values that need to be managed for a specific project. A large case study is used involving one university and one industry collaborating on a multi-million Euro initiative over six years. Empirical research was conducted by researchers who observed at close quarters, the challenges and successes of managing the competing values of key stakeholders.
Findings
The value framework takes a stakeholders' perspective by identifying the respective PM values for each of six stakeholders: university–industry consortium, university, industry, R&D external entities, funding entity and society.
Research limitations/implications
The research was performed using only one case study which limits the generalisability of its findings; however, the findings are presented as a decision support aid for project consortia in developing values for their own collaboration.
Practical implications
Guidance and decision support are provided to multi-stakeholder research consortia when selecting values that need to be managed for achieving tangible and intangible project benefits.
Originality/value
The paper demonstrates a proposed framework for designing and managing the value of PM in large multi-stakeholder university–industry R&D projects.

Abstract
Purpose
To increase university–industry collaboration and research commercialisation, the Australian government recently introduced the Intellectual Property (IP) Framework, a set of online standard contracts. This follows a predecessor standard contract initiative, the IP Toolkit, which has not previously been evaluated. This paper aims to examine standard contracting in the innovation sector, tracing the policymaking behind the IP Toolkit using the lens of Macneil’s relational contract theory, to assess prospects of success for the new IP Framework, and similar initiatives in other jurisdictions.
Design/methodology/approach
This is a disciplined-configurative case study, drawing on qualitative secondary data analysis and applying Macneil’s relational contracting theory to guide case construction and generate hypotheses around likely success of standard contracting initiatives (stakeholder sentiment, stakeholder adoption). Within-case analysis process-traces development of the IP Toolkit, to discover what the policymakers wanted, knew and computed – and to detail observable implications Macneil’s theory predicts. Its themes are triangulated with multiple sources.
Findings
The case study, via Macneil’s theory, confirms the first hypothesis (resistant stakeholder sentiment) and partly validates the second hypothesis (low levels of adoption), demonstrating limited suitability of standard contracting in the dynamic and highly uncertain space of university–industry collaboration.
Research limitations/implications
The study provides insights into the limited role that standard contracts can play in improving national collaborative research and development performance.
Originality/value
This is a novel theory-driven case study triangulated with previously unpublished data on the IP Toolkit’s website usage, and data from recent consultations on the new IP Framework. It has broader implications for other jurisdictions considering adoption of the standard contract model.

Abstract
Purpose
The purpose of this paper is to investigate how knowledge management and university-industry-government collaboration – including the triple helix – relate with each other in influencing organizations’ performance. In the competitive environment nowadays, an organization’s ability to create and use knowledge becomes ever more essential in the search for sustainable competitive advantage, even leading to the search for new forms of inter-organizational arrangements.
Design/methodology/approach
The representatives of such collaborations selected for this study are the National Institutes of Science and Technology. The categorical content analysis technique was used for the qualitative analysis of the data.
Findings
The principal contribution was the proposal of an analytical model relating the knowledge management and triple helix theories and the proposed dimensions (namely, structural, relational, cognitive and the context), considering the peculiarities of the Brazilian context. The findings show that the organizational structure (structural) influences not only the relationship among members (relational) but also the flow of knowledge (cognitive), as well as how relational elements (collaborative culture, trust and leadership) facilitate knowledge sharing. Moreover, the context affects these three other dimensions. The main obstacles identified were cultural differences, bureaucracy and the socio-economic reality, while facilitators were the existence of technology parks and incubators, government incentives and geographical proximity between universities and industry.
Originality/value
This topic was chosen as there are few empirical studies that comprehensively relate the topics of knowledge management and university-industry-government cooperation focusing on the Brazilian context.

Abstract
We examine the determinants of multinational firms’ propensity to conduct R&D activities in host countries, with specific attention to the influence of host countries’ university research. We consider heterogeneous locational drivers related to the type of R&D activity: basic research, applied research, development for local markets, and development for global markets. Drawing on official survey data on R&D activities by 498 Japanese multinational firms in 24 host countries and estimating two-stage models, we find that the likelihood that firms conduct R&D in a host country is generally increasing in the strength of university research. Conditional on a firm’s R&D presence, university research strength is associated with a greater propensity to conduct (basic) research activities rather than (local) development, while the intensity of host country university–industry collaboration is most strongly associated with applied research. Host country experience and the depth of the firm’s manufacturing presence are also associated higher propensities to engage in research.

Abstract
University–industry collaborations are an important driver of innovation that highlights the benefits of collaborative processes across organizational boundaries. However, like in most collaborative processes, many challenges remain when trying to manage the process of knowledge sharing and interaction in university–industry partnerships. In this chapter, the authors specifically investigate how leadership as a managerial dimension facilitates collaboration within university–industry joint laboratories. The authors present an explorative and inductive case study of eight joint laboratories set up by Telecom Italia within five major Italian universities. The results show that the laboratory directors play a crucial role in providing a dynamic and socially active working environment, which is enabled through a process of sensemaking and sensegiving. The authors, moreover, find that this process plays a crucial role by shaping effective communication channels that facilitate knowledge sharing and transfer of information. The authors find that this process ultimately acts as a mediator between charismatic leadership on the individual level and distributed leadership on the collective level.
